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7186171 58742 16 72 5206
2501927 4778240
2501927 4778240
2019974692 58323 9709719
All about undefined
Interested in learning more?
2501927 4778240
2019974692 58323 9709719
See more
872 737 9446
90 5052216565 84824
See more
012 362 593283
490 07 783
See more